Challenges such as a downward trend in cultivation and post-harvest losses lead to increased gap in cocoa bean supply and demand. This review deals with the recent AI models used in farming, processing, and supply chain of cocoa beans. Farming models viz. XAI-CROP, Random Forest, and Gradient Boosting can detect cocoa diseases, recommend appropriate pesticides, enable targeted crop spraying, count the number of pods on cocoa trees, and indicate cocoa pod ripeness. Processing models involving AI viz. Artificial Neural Network, Bootstrap Forest fermentation, and Particle Swarm Optimisation were explored for their efficiency in technological steps viz. drying, roasting, conching, and tempering to obtain high-quality chocolates. The supply chain models used AI such as Decision Tree, Multi-level Perception and Long Short-Term memory for cold storage, traceability, and deforestation prediction. AI can thus be used to standardise the quality of produce by optimal resource utilisation leading to minimal impact on the environment.
